The Big Sleep (1939) is a hardboiled crime novel by American-British writer Raymond Chandler, the first to feature the detective Philip Marlowe. It has been adapted for film twice, in 1946 and again in 1978. The story is set in Los Angeles. WebArthur Gwynn Geiger ’s companion and implied lover, the young and handsome Carol Lundgren kills a grifter called Joe Brody, who he thinks murdered his partner. Philip Marlowe overpowers Lundgren as he flees the scene of the crime. Marlowe turns Lundgren over to the police.
